Order Food To Your Office

Order Food To Your Office

Need to order food to your office in Dublin? The Food Crew are the perfect choice for you – offering fresh and tasty food with a variety of options that can cater to allergies and dietary requirements. Based in Sandyford, our chefs have a real passion for what they do...